ESP pressure sensor 1
Hi all
Have the dreaded esp/bas light on, intermittently, have had the codes read with the result C1141 pressure sensor current - 008 + zero point and offset of stored component B34/1 (ESP pressure sensor 1) anybody out there any idea? have renewed brake pedal switch. Car runs ok when light is on, seems less likely to illuminate when started with foot on the brake pedal. would help if I knew where esp pressure switch 1 is located never posted before hope this is correct etiquette Thanks |

Re: ESP pressure sensor 1
Thanks for the info.
printed off relevant pages of workshop manual found out esp pressure switch 1 is mounted on the master cylinder. cleaned connections etc, still the same. purchased second hand slk master cylinder with sensors, replaced sensor, bled brakes- no esp light so far! cost £25 and some brake fluid.
